Supplementary material of Kristallbrockensalt microstructures of the Zechstein-2 rock salt from the Northern Netherlands
<p>This dataset represents supporting data for the paper entitled <strong>Grain size dependent large rheology contrasts of halite at low deviatoric stress: evidence from microstructural study of naturally deformed gneissic Zechstein-2 rock salt (Kristallbrockensalz) from the Northern Netherlands</strong> <strong>, </strong>which has been submitted to <strong>Solid Earth </strong>journal</p> <p>The so-called Kristallbrocken salt has a unique and quite spectacular grain size distribution and marks an important horizon throughout the entire Permian Basin. Based on microstructural observations we interpret that fine grained halite deformed much weaker (i.e. faster) and has characteristic pressure-solution structures, as compared to much less deformed Kristallbrocken megacrystals that developed subgrains during dislocation creep.</p> <p>This dataset contains (1) a collection of addiational micrographs from gamma irradiated halite thin sections, (2) high resolution sample overview scans in tramsmitted and reflected light microscopy and grain and subgrainsize measurements, (3) Supportind EBSD material, (4) BIB-SEM material and (5) XRD results of sedond phase inclusions.</p> <p>(1), (3) and (4) are compiled in PowerPoint (.pptx) format, (2) contains multiple files of microscopical images or panoramas overlain with interpreted digitized grain and subgrain boundaries compiled in Inkscape (.svg) files together with corresponding measurements in Excel (.xls) files and (5) a text document (.txt) of XRD second phase results.</p>
FIG. 1 in Anatomy and taphonomy of a coniferous wood from the Zechstein (Upper Permian) of NW-Hesse (Germany)
FIG. 1. — Map indicating the position of the locality Frankenberg-Geismar; A, schematic map of the geographic extent of the Zechstein Sea (in grey) in Western and Central Europe; B, map indicating the outcrops of Zechstein-sediments (grey) in NW-Hesse and the locality Frankenberg-Geismar ().

FIG. 3 in Anatomy and taphonomy of a coniferous wood from the Zechstein (Upper Permian) of NW-Hesse (Germany)
FIG. 3. —?Brachyoxylon sp. from the Zechstein (Upper Permian) of Frankenberg-Geismar (NW-Hesse); A, cross-section, showing cracks filled with pyrite (Pb-WB-H-1/a); B, radial section, showing "spirally thickened" (probably checked during desiccation) tracheid walls (arrows) (Pb-WB-H-1/d); C, radial section, showing remains of a ray (arrow) with very poorly preserved cross-field pitting (Pb-WB-H-1/d); D, radial section, showing uniseriate, circular bordered pits (arrow) (Pb-WB-H-1/d). Scale bars: A, 1 mm; B, 150 µm; C, D, 100 µm.
